2026 NCAA Baseball Tournament Bracket: Schedule, TV revealed for Friday, first day of regionals
The 2026 NCAA Baseball Tournament and bracket has been officially set. After the full reveal, the schedule and TV information for Friday, the opening day of regional weekend, was released.
As always, regionals are played in a double-elimination format. The No. 1 seed in each regional will take on their No. 4 seed, with the No. 2 and 3 seeds facing off on Friday. The winners will then move on to play on Saturday, as will the losers.
The winner of each regional will advance to the Super Regionals. For the hosts ranked as a top eight seed, they will host the Super Regional round if they win their regional.
The action is set to get underway on Friday at 12 noon ET. The host of each regional decides if they want to play the first or second game on Friday. Here’s where everyone lands.
